Transportation Economic Trends 2016
Tuesday, June 27, 2017
Transportation plays a vital role in the American economy: it makes economic activity possible, and serves as a major economic activity in its own right.
This report is BTS’s first stand-alone volume on transportation and the economy, and uses a variety of data series to highlight relevant trends and explain related measurement concepts.
